  1. Stevens Point is a city in and the county seat of Portage County, Wisconsin, United States. [6] Its population was 25,666 as of the 2020 census . [ 7 ] It forms the core of the Stevens Point micropolitan statistical area , which had a population of 70,377 in 2020.

  7. UW-Stevens Point has more than 77,000 alumni. More than half of these alumni live in Wisconsin. In 1968, UW-Stevens Point formed the Northwoods battalion, an ROTC unit for the United States Army. [10] Lee S. Dreyfus became chancellor in 1974 before becoming Wisconsin's 40th governor.
